Runbook fragment — remote runs, section 4. When spare parts head out to the Vossen Ridge site, log the crate numbers before the van leaves, not after — we've been burned on that twice. Records team gets the packing list, driver gets the duplicate. Weather can close the access road, so note any reschedule. The courier hand-over line is appended below.

courier memo of yawep-yafog: the pramir ulaix courier leaves the ulavan aldix frair zorok oliiel joreth rusdor fenvan ledger at gate 1305 under passcode 514738

**Finance Review Summary — Warranty-Cost Overrun, Pellham Drives**

For the incoming director. Warranty claims on the Pellham drive line ran forty percent over forecast, driven by a seal defect from supplier Granwick Forge. Reserve topped up; margin impact contained to one quarter. Recovery talks underway. Corrective tooling ships next month. The confidential remediation plan follows below.

confidential, kagep-kahof: Druokax Systems plans to lower the Ulaath list price by 53 percent in March.

Subject: Handover — TaxGrid rate-lookup cache

Hi Marisol,

Before you take over the TaxGrid release, note that the rate-lookup cache now invalidates on jurisdiction updates rather than a fixed TTL. Please review the eviction path in cachecore/taxrates carefully; a stale entry caused the Q3 rollback. Warm the cache in staging before promoting. The deploy must be signed before the pipeline accepts it, so use the key below.

signing key of bagap-yawep = bky13_TbfT6ZMUoGJo2

## Deployment

Haskvale places a bloom filter in front of the Drennet KV store to short-circuit lookups for absent keys. False positives fall through to the store; false negatives are impossible. The filter is rebuilt on deploy from a key snapshot, never mutated in place. No user data leaves the filter tier. Deployment reads these values at boot.

deployment values, kajep-kageg:
[praix]
host = praix.paliqcorp.corp
user = praix_svc
database = praix_prod